Transaction 21fb0415e45f6f77a92c4ba69f031012cacb17b339bced3d2ac697f6b4fd1a08

16 Input
1 Outputs
  • 21fb0415e45f6f77a92c4ba69f031012cacb17b339bced3d2ac697f6b4fd1a08:0
  • value  700000000
    address  364GZhRf2tCUx1vC4hdn5B3QCZhPaNoqzE